STEP 1: Contact your public school to set up an "in home" visit.  If you are concerned about your child’s development, contact your local school district’s Early Childhood Special Education program to find out if he or she is eligible for early intervention services. Screening and evaluation are provided at no cost to you.

STEP 2: Call a local diganostic center to have your child evaluated for the suspected developmental delays.  Since you may have to wait 6-9 months to get your child seen by a licensed psychologist, be sure to complete STEP 1 right away and then move onto STEP 3 quickly.
